When Is Professional Tree Removal Necessary?
Trees enhance our properties with beauty and shade, but certain situations demand their removal. Professional intervention becomes essential when trees show signs of disease, severe damage, or death. These compromised trees can unexpectedly drop large branches or completely topple, threatening nearby structures and people.
Additionally, trees growing too close to buildings, power lines, or underground utilities often require removal. Root systems can damage foundations, sidewalks, and plumbing, while branches near power lines create fire hazards. Sometimes, tree removal becomes necessary during construction projects or landscape redesigns where existing trees interfere with planned structures or features.
Storm-damaged trees represent another common scenario requiring professional attention. When severe weather compromises a tree's structural integrity, removal might be the safest option rather than attempting preservation. Professional arborists can evaluate whether a tree can be saved or if removal represents the only safe solution.
The Tree Removal Process Explained
Professional tree removal follows a systematic approach to ensure safety and efficiency. The process typically begins with a thorough assessment of the tree and surrounding area. Arborists evaluate factors like the tree's size, condition, location, and proximity to structures or utility lines to develop the appropriate removal strategy.
For standard removals, professionals first clear the surrounding area and establish safety zones. The actual cutting process usually starts from the top, with workers systematically removing branches and sections of the trunk in a controlled manner called sectional dismantling. For trees in open areas, directional felling might be possible, where the entire tree is cut to fall in a predetermined direction.
Equipment used varies based on the tree's size and location. Common tools include chainsaws, rigging equipment, cranes for large trees, wood chippers, and specialized climbing gear. Most services include cutting the tree down to a stump, while stump removal or grinding typically requires additional services. The debris management approach varies by company – some include hauling away all materials, while others might offer wood chipping or leave usable logs for firewood.
Comparing Professional Tree Removal Services
When selecting a tree removal service, comparing providers helps ensure quality work at reasonable prices. Certification and insurance should top your checklist – reputable companies employ certified arborists and maintain comprehensive insurance coverage. Tree Care Industry Association certification indicates adherence to industry standards, while proper insurance protects you from liability during the removal process.

Benefits and Limitations of Professional Removal
Professional tree removal offers significant advantages over DIY approaches. Safety represents the primary benefit – trained professionals understand proper cutting techniques and use specialized equipment to manage even hazardous removals safely. This expertise substantially reduces the risk of property damage or personal injury during the removal process.
Efficiency constitutes another key advantage. What might take an inexperienced homeowner days to complete, professionals can often accomplish in hours. Companies like Asplundh specialize in efficient removals even in challenging conditions. Additionally, professionals bring proper equipment scaled to the job's requirements, from climbing gear for precision work to cranes for large tree removal.
However, professional services do have limitations. Cost represents the most significant drawback, with prices ranging from hundreds to thousands of dollars depending on the tree's size and complexity. Scheduling can also present challenges, as reputable companies often book weeks in advance during busy seasons. Some companies have minimum job requirements, making smaller projects proportionally more expensive.

Understanding Tree Removal Pricing
Tree removal costs vary widely based on several factors. Tree size typically influences price most significantly – larger trees require more labor, equipment, and time to remove safely. Location also impacts pricing – trees near structures, power lines, or with limited access command premium pricing due to increased complexity and risk.
The tree's condition affects cost calculations too. Dead or diseased trees often cost less to remove because they're lighter and less dense, while healthy trees with full canopies require more extensive work. Emergency removals, such as after storm damage, typically incur higher charges due to the urgent nature of the work and potential hazards.
Additional services beyond basic removal contribute to total costs. Stump grinding typically adds $100-300 depending on size, while debris removal and hauling services increase the final bill. Companies like ArborCare often offer package pricing that combines removal with stump grinding and cleanup for better value.
Geographic location significantly influences pricing due to regional labor costs, regulatory requirements, and competition levels. Urban areas generally command higher prices than rural locations due to access challenges and additional safety precautions required in densely populated areas.
